Billie Eilish briefly stopped her London gig at London’s O2 Arena on Saturday night after fans began to struggle in the hot temperatures.
The 20-year-old singer paused to check fans were ‘all okay’ as they were squashed at the front of the stage. This, with the combination of hot temperatures, made conditions difficult, particularly for the fans in the front rows.
Billie urged fans to take a step back in order to ‘give everybody some space’ and asked the security team at the O2 to hand out water to the audience.Are you squished a little bit? If someone looks a little woozy, just tell someone, okay? Don’t try to save feelings,’ she told the crowd.People were fainting and getting pulled out,’ she continued as she halted the show briefly. ‘It’s hot, I know, it’s crowded, it’s hot,’ she said.
At another point, members of the audience formed a protective circle around one fan who was struggling in the heat and alerted security staff with the lights on their phones.Billie is known for taking fan safety very seriously at her shows.
The Bad Guy hitmaker previously stopped a gig to help a fan who needed medical assistance during a performance in the US in February during her Happier than Ever tour.
‘I’ll wait for people to be okay until I keep going,’ she was heard saying.
